Transaction 3ec43af6de19cd228b59aa7e6a78fbf72c89ccabc43cf1370e3899d45170d955
1 Input
1 Output
-
3ec43af6de19cd228b59aa7e6a78fbf72c89ccabc43cf1370e3899d45170d955:0
- value
- 1745068
- script pubkey
- OP_0 OP_PUSHBYTES_20 42d2dcd779c56fd66727212c084b627c1ce27678
- address
- bc1qgtfde4mec4havee8yykqsjmz0swwyancu67peh